Lesley Manville Wins Big at the Tonys. Broadway's Best Actress Race Was Stacked.

The 79th Tony Awards saw Lesley Manville take home the prize for best actress in a play, in a category that reflected Broadway's current state: older, more diverse, and increasingly willing to celebrate performers with decades of work behind them. Manville's win matters not because she's British (though she is, and that signals something about where Broadway's talent pool draws from) but because it confirms a trend the industry has been quietly acknowledging for months.
